Can I register as an individual?
The challenge of coordinating teams, ride times and ride length requirements
for all individuals is very complex due to the large number of participants
expected. We do not want to disappoint any participants, so the best way to
participate in 12-Hour Cycle For A Cure is to become a team captain and
collect the $250 registration fee from yourself and your team members.

Can I ride a bike all by myself?
You can as long as you pay the bike fee and raise the minimum amount of
$100 in pledges. There is no limit on ride times (although there is a limit of 12
riders to a team), but each participant must submit the minimum pledge.

Why is there a minimum pledge amount?
The event hopes to raise as much money as possible for JDRF. There are
costs associated with running a large event such as this and the bike fee
really covers just that. We are hoping that the pledges will raise the money we
need to reach our fund raising goals.

What will be provided at the event?
All participants will receive T-shirt and goodie bag as a welcome prize. In
addition there will be food and drink throughout the event.

Why is there a minimum age?
The bikes are adult size and cannot be safely ridden by any age under 12.

What does 12 Hour Cycle For A Cure support?
12 Hour Cycle For A Cure supports The Juvenile Diabetes Research
Foundation, Greater Dallas Chapter.  
They are located at 9400 N. Central
Expressway, Suite 1201 in Dallas, Texas.
 JDRF is an organization founded on
and driven by a single goal: to find a cure for diabetes and its complications
through the support of research.
